Retro video games delivered to your door every month!
Click above to get retro games delivered to your door ever month!
X-Hacker.org- Watcom C/C++ v10.0 : C library - <b>synopsis:</b> http://www.X-Hacker.org [<<Previous Entry] [^^Up^^] [Next Entry>>] [Menu] [About The Guide]
Synopsis:
    #include <string.h>
    int stricmp( const char *s1, const char *s2 );
    int _fstricmp( const char __far *s1,
                   const char __far *s2 );

Description:
    The stricmp and _fstricmp functions compare, with case insensitivity,
    the string pointed to by s1 to the string pointed to by s2.  All
    uppercase characters from s1 and s2 are mapped to lowercase for the
    purposes of doing the comparison.

    The _fstricmp function is a data model independent form of the stricmp
    function that accepts far pointer arguments.  It is most useful in mixed
    memory model applications.

Returns:
    The stricmp and _fstricmp functions return an integer less than, equal
    to, or greater than zero, indicating that the string pointed to by s1 is
    less than, equal to, or greater than the string pointed to by s2.

See Also:
    strcmp, _fstrcmp, strcmpi, strncmp, _fstrncmp, strnicmp, _fstrnicmp

Example:
    #include <stdio.h>
    #include <string.h>

    void main()
      {
        printf( "%d\n", stricmp( "AbCDEF", "abcdef" ) );
        printf( "%d\n", stricmp( "abcdef", "ABC"    ) );
        printf( "%d\n", stricmp( "abc",    "ABCdef" ) );
        printf( "%d\n", stricmp( "Abcdef", "mnopqr" ) );
        printf( "%d\n", stricmp( "Mnopqr", "abcdef" ) );
      }

    produces the following:

    0
    100
    -100
    -12
    12

Classification:
    WATCOM

Systems:
     stricmp - All

    _fstricmp - All

Online resources provided by: http://www.X-Hacker.org --- NG 2 HTML conversion by Dave Pearson